Akbar assures fire victims from Jittu Estate that they will be assisted

Two families who lost their home in a fire in Jittu Estate yesterday have been assured of assistance by the Minister for Women, Children and Poverty Alleviation, Rosy Akbar.

Akbar met with Peni Bari and Viniana Adinaulu today.

Akbar says their aim is to provide immediate relief and by providing Government assistance in such cases, they are doing their best to ease the families burden.

Akbar says they will look at all aspects and assist the families accordingly.

She says Bari will be assisted with the Government-funded Fire Insurance claim as he is a beneficiary of the Social Pension Scheme.

Akbar adds the other family is not on any of the welfare schemes, however, they qualify to be helped with the Fire Relief Assistance.

76 year old Bari says Akbar’s visit brings relief to their family and they had requested if she could provide food and other immediate basic needs.

Akbar has also provided immediate food supplies to Bari.
